Understanding the Importance of Video Metadata

Metadata is the foundation of video SEO. It includes elements like titles, descriptions, tags, and categories that help search engines understand your content.

  • Compelling Titles: Craft clear, keyword-rich titles that accurately describe your video. Think about what your audience would search for.

  • Detailed Descriptions: Write informative descriptions that expand on your content, incorporating relevant keywords naturally. Include links, calls-to-action, and timestamps if applicable.

  • Tags and Categories: Use relevant keywords as tags to improve searchability. Categorise your videos appropriately to help platforms understand context.

Transcripts and Captions: Boosting Accessibility and SEO

Adding transcripts and captions offers multiple benefits:

  • SEO Boost: Transcripts allow search engines to crawl your video content more effectively, increasing the chances of ranking for spoken keywords.

  • Accessibility: Captions make your videos accessible to a broader audience, including those with hearing impairments.

  • Viewer Engagement: Captions can improve viewer retention, encouraging longer watch times, which is favourable for SEO.

Creating Eye-Catching Thumbnails

Your thumbnail is often the first impression viewers have of your video. A compelling thumbnail can dramatically increase click-through rates.

  • Design Tips: Use high-resolution images with bright colors, clear text, and relevant visuals.

  • Consistency: Maintain a consistent style that aligns with your brand to build recognition.

  • Preview Content: Ensure your thumbnail accurately represents the video’s content to meet viewer expectations.

Choosing the Right Hosting Platforms

Platform choice impacts discoverability:

  • YouTube Optimization: As the world’s second-largest search engine, YouTube’s algorithm favors well-optimized videos. Use keywords in titles, descriptions, and tags, and encourage engagement.

  • Embedding and Sharing: Host your videos on your website or other platforms with embedded players to drive traffic and improve SEO signals.

  • Video Sitemaps: Submit video sitemaps to search engines to help them index your video content more efficiently.

Additional Tips for Maximizing Video Marketing SEO

  • Consistent Posting Schedule: Regular uploads signal activity and relevance to platforms’ algorithms.

  • Encourage Engagement: Likes, comments, and shares boost your video’s visibility.

  • Use End Screens and Cards: Guide viewers to other content, increasing watch time and session duration.

  • Analyse and Adjust: Use analytics tools to track performance and refine your SEO strategies accordingly.
